Global Racing Team Step Up Sponsor Hunt

Next Sunday, the 8th April, the British women’s professional team GLOBAL RACING TEAM will be at the “Départ” of the great Tour des Flandres World Cup.

 The team has started the road season with the Het Volk (UCI 1.2) and have already scored 5 top 10 results in Europe as well as having a rider in the top 10 at the World Track Championships.  

In 2007 the team has the following riders: 

  • Helen WYMAN – UK Cyclo-Cross Champion, World Number 3
  • Louise MORIARTY – Irish Time Trial Champion
  • Linn TORP – Norweigan Road Race Champion, Norweigan Criterium Champion
  • Jo ROWSELL – UK under 23 Road Race Champion
  • Lizzie ARMITSTEAD – UK Criterium Champion
  • Gabriella DAY – World Number 19 Cyclo-Cross Rider
  • Masami MASIMO – Twice Japanese Cyclo-Cross Champion
  • Katie CURTIS – Great Britain Team member 2007 World Track Championships (8th Points Race)
  • Nikki Harris – 3rd Track world Cup 2006 Sydney, 8th Commonwealth Games Points Race
  • Line RAMSRUD
  • Emma SILVERSIDES
  • Linda RINGLEVER
  • Debby VAN DEN BERG


After the Spring Classic of next Sunday, the team has already got a busy schedule over the summer with major one day races and stage races including :

  • Ronde van Gelderland
  • Tour de l’Aude
  • Tour de Bretagne,
  • Trophée d’Or Féminin
  • Tour de l’Ardèche


With these great young riders and an equally impressive race program, Global Racing Team are one of the most progressive teams in the world scene and are looking for new sponsorship avenues. 

Team Manager Stefan Wyman say, ‘We have managed to put the team in a great possition for 2007 and we are looking to keep the progression at its current level.  This requires us to gain more sponsorship from both in the cycle industry and outside it.  I have no doubt that we will provide the best value sponsorship for anyone looking to enter the sponsorship areana.  12 months a year we are proving our backers possitive coverage and consitanly gaining top results’.
